Catholic Central High School in Burlington, Wisconsin, United States, is a private, Catholic, co-educational high school in the Archdiocese of Milwaukee. Founded in 1920,[2] it offers both college-prep and general studies for grades 9 through 12.[3]

Accreditation[edit]

CCHS is a member of the National Catholic Educational Association and is accredited by AdvancED.
